Where do these valuation figures come from?

Yields and quality metrics are computed from the same SEC TTM figures as the financials page, against the live market cap. Historical bands reconstruct month-end market cap from split-adjusted closes and the share count in the units it was filed, then divide by those dollar totals. Nothing here is a third-party estimate.

Source: SEC filings for the fundamentals; split-adjusted Yahoo closes and recorded stock splits for historical market cap.
